Model Year | 2007 | 2006 | |
Model | Cadillac DTS | Toyota Camry | |
Engine | 4.6L V8 DOHC-4v 275 hp@5200 292 lb-ft@4400 |
3.3L V6 DOHC-4v 210 hp@5600 220 lb-ft@3600 |
|
Transmission | 4-speed automatic | 5-speed automatic | |
Drivetrain | FWD | FWD | |
Body | 4dr Sedan | 4dr Sedan | |
Difference | |||
Wheelbase | 115.6 in | 107.1 in | 8.5 in |
Length | 207.6 in | 189.2 in | 18.4 in |
Width | 74.8 in | 70.7 in | 4.1 in |
Height | 57.6 in | 58.7 in | -1.1 in |
Curb Weight | 4009 lb. | 3450 lb. | 559 lb. |
Fuel Capacity | 18.5 gal. | 18.5 gal. | 0 gal. |
Headroom, Row 1 | 38.3 in | 39.2 in | -0.9 in |
Shoulder Room, Row 1 | 60.0 in | 57.5 in | 2.5 in |
Hip Room, Row 1 | 57.3 in | 54.4 in | 2.9 in |
Legroom, Row 1 | 42.5 in | 41.6 in | 0.9 in |
Headroom, Row 2 | 38.4 in | 38.4 in | 0 in |
Shoulder Room, Row 2 | 59.2 in | 56.7 in | 2.5 in |
Hip Room, Row 2 | 55.7 in | 54.1 in | 1.6 in |
Legroom, Row 2 | 42.0 in | 37.8 in | 4.2 in |
Total Legroom | 84.5 in (over 2 rows) | 79.4 in (over 2 rows) | 5.1 in |
Cargo Volume | 18.8 ft3 | 16.7 ft3 | 2.1 ft3 |
